Protecting America’s Economic Sovereignty: President Trump Takes Action

President Donald J. Trump has taken a bold stance to safeguard American companies and innovators from foreign exploitation by signing a memorandum today. This memorandum aims to defend America’s tax base and prevent overseas governments from extorting revenue from U.S. businesses.

Combatting Unfair Digital Service Taxes

The Administration will not hesitate to implement responsive actions, such as tariffs, against digital service taxes (DSTs) imposed by foreign governments on American companies. DSTs allow foreign nations to collect taxes from U.S. companies operating in their markets, even though these companies are not subject to their jurisdiction. President Trump is determined to prevent foreign governments from appropriating America’s tax base for their own benefit.

Under the memorandum, the United States Trade Representative (USTR) will renew investigations into DSTs under Section 301 initiated during the President’s first term. Additionally, any countries employing DSTs to discriminate against U.S. companies will be subject to further scrutiny.

Defending American Companies from Extortion

President Trump’s memorandum presents a comprehensive strategy to ensure that U.S. products and services are governed by American laws, not foreign regulations. Foreign governments have been unfairly taxing the success of American companies, undermining the competitiveness of the U.S. economy.

Foreign governments have implemented DSTs and other unfair practices that hinder American companies’ operations and impose compliance costs. This exploitation not only impacts American businesses but also erodes U.S. global economic competitiveness.

Despite these challenges, the United States remains a dominant force in the digital economy, driven by American tech companies, innovation, and workers. President Trump is committed to restoring America’s entrepreneurial spirit and protecting the interests of American manufacturers and workers.

Promoting Fair Trade Policies

President Trump’s track record of protecting American industries is evident through his actions against unfair trade practices. During his first term, he initiated Section 301 cases against DSTs and negotiated trade agreements that benefit American businesses.

President Trump’s “Fair and Reciprocal Plan” aims to restore fairness in U.S. trade relationships and counter non-reciprocal agreements. His America First Trade Policy prioritizes American economic growth and industry revitalization.

By taking a firm stance against foreign exploitation and implementing measures to protect American businesses, President Trump is working to ensure that America’s economic sovereignty remains intact.
